Captain Suryakumar Yadav, who was struggling with poor form for a long time, was an excellent batsman in Raipur and India returned by winning by seven wickets. In the second T20 match against New Zealand, he scored unbeaten 82 runs in 37 balls after getting the target of 209. He hit 9 fours and four sixes. This is Surya’s first half-century in 24 innings since October 2024. Surya gaining momentum and batting aggressively before the T20 World Cup 2026 is a good sign for India. He scored 24 runs in the ninth over bowled by Jack Foulkes, which can give an idea of the aggression of the Indian captain. Surya has broken the record of former veteran all-rounder Yuvraj Singh. Actually, Suryakumar has reached second place in the list of Indian players who have scored 20 or more runs most times in T20 International cricket. He has done this feat five times so far in his career. Yuvraj scored 20+ runs in an over four times. Topping the list is ‘Hitman’ Rohit Sharma. He accomplished this feat six times. Rohit has retired from Test and T20 International. Let us tell you that Surya hit fours on the first four balls of Foulkes who came for the ninth inning. He hit a six on the fifth ball and a double on the last ball. Foulkes also bowled a wide ball.

Most times 20+ runs in an over for India in T20I
6 – Rohit Sharma
5 – Suryakumar Yadav
4 – Yuvraj Singh
3 – Rinku Singh
3 – Hardik Pandya
3 – Rituraj Gaikwad
3 – Sanju Samson
2 – Ravindra Jadeja
2 – Abhishek Sharma
Surya made two important partnerships in Raipur T20. He made a partnership of 122 runs with Ishan Kishan in just 49 balls. Ishaan scored 76 runs in 32 balls with the help of 11 fours and four sixes. He was elected player of the match. The captain led the team to victory with an unbroken partnership of 81 runs in 37 balls for the fourth wicket with Shivam Dubey (36 not out). With this, India equaled its record of successfully chasing the highest score in T20 International. The team had earlier scored 209 runs while chasing the target against Australia in Visakhapatnam in 2023.
